LMAO Re: White cupboards and young kids - a good or bad idea? 14Mar 27, 2010 7:07 pm I had white laminate cupboards in previous kitchen with a dark bench and have decided to go the opposite in the new build ie. darker cupboards and white bench top. I found with a 4 yr old and 1 yr old the marks on the coupboards were constant and drove me around the bend. I do think however that the finish of the cupboards makes a huge difference - I had a matt white finish which seemed to 'hold' the dirt/marks and made it really hard to clean - it wasn't just a simple wipe off - every mark required the spray and elbow grease!! So maybe a gloss would be easier to clean??? Go with whatever colour/look you love and then keeping the kitchen clean won't be a chore!! Mel - jumping in feet first to my first owner build!!
